首先我們要了解到乙個概念:
埠:可以認為是裝置與外界通訊交流的出口。埠可分為虛擬埠和物理埠,其中虛擬埠指計算機內部或交換機路由器內的埠,不可見。例如計算機中的80埠、21埠、23埠等。物理埠又稱為介面,是可見埠,計算機背板的rj45網口,交換機路由器集線器等rj45埠。**使用rj11插口也屬於物理埠的範疇。
詳解:如果把ip位址比作一間房子 ,埠就是出入這間房子的門。真正的房子只有幾個門,但是乙個ip位址的埠可以有65536(即:2^16)個之多!埠是通過埠號來標記的,埠號只有整數,範圍是從0 到65535(2^16-1)。
在internet上,各主機間通過tcp/ip協議傳送和接收資料報,各個資料報根據其目的主機的ip位址來進行網際網路絡中的路由選擇,把資料報順利的傳送到目的主機。大多數作業系統都支援多程式(程序)同時執行,那麼目的主機應該把接收到的資料報傳送給眾多同時執行的程序中的哪乙個呢?顯然這個問題有待解決,埠機制便由此被引入進來。
本地作業系統會給那些有需求的程序分配協議埠(protocol port,即我們常說的埠),每個協議埠由乙個正整數標識,如:80,139,445,等等。當目的主機接收到資料報後,將根據報文首部的目的埠號,把資料傳送到相應埠,而與此埠相對應的那個程序將會領取資料並等待下一組資料的到來。說到這裡,埠的概念似乎仍然抽象,那麼繼續跟我來,別走開。
埠其實就是隊,作業系統為各個程序分配了不同的隊,資料報按照目的埠被推入相應的隊中,等待被程序取用,在極特殊的情況下,這個隊也是有可能溢位的,不過作業系統允許各程序指定和調整自己的隊的大小。
不光接受資料報的程序需要開啟它自己的埠,傳送資料報的程序也需要開啟埠,這樣,資料報中將會標識有源埠,以便接受方能順利地回傳資料報到這個埠。
內網:內網通俗的說就是區域網,是幾台或者幾十台電腦之間互相連線用於資源共享的網路。比如鄰居之間的電腦連成內網打cs。
外網通俗的說就是與網際網路相通的。可以訪問網際網路上的所有網路資源。
如果你用的是adsl連線的就是外網。
簡單的說,自己的單位或者家庭、小區內部有區域網;單位、家庭之外有覆蓋範圍極大的網路,比如internet,這個大網路延伸到了我們的單位、家庭(通過光纖、網線、**線等)。
我們把自己的區域網連線到internet上,那麼我們的訪問範圍就從區域網擴充套件到了整個internet。這時候,就說區域網是內網,internet是外網。
再簡單的說,如果你家有5臺電腦相連,這5臺電腦構成的系統就是區域網;如果你家又開通寬頻,那麼網際網路就是外網;你家這5臺電腦組成的區域網就是內網。
adsl與lan的區別
埠對映:埠對映就是將外網主機的ip位址的乙個埠對映到內網中一台機器,提供相應的服務。當使用者訪問該ip的這個埠時,伺服器自動將請求對映到對應區域網內部的機器上。
通俗來講,埠對映是將一台主機的內網(lan)ip位址對映成乙個公網(wan)ip位址,當使用者訪問提供對映埠主機的某個埠時,伺服器將請求轉移到本地區域網內部提供這種特定服務的主機;利用埠對映功能還可以將一台外網ip位址機器的多個埠對映到內網不同機器上的不同埠。 埠對映功能還可以完成一些特定**功能,比如**pop,smtp,telnet等協議。理論上可以提供65535(總埠數)-1024(保留埠數)=64511個埠的對映。 [1]
舉例說明如何設定埠對映:例如要對映一台ip位址為192.168.111.10的web伺服器,只需把伺服器的ip位址192.168.111.10和提供web服務的tcp埠80填入到路由器的埠對映表中即可。 [1]
多客戶每天都問為什麼要埠對映?例如:通過路由器上網的,**自己可以訪問,但是別人就不能;輸入127.0.0.1可以訪問,別人還是看不到;輸入localhost可以看到,但是別人就是看不到,氣人啊~沒辦法,只有進行埠映** [1]
計算機網路埠詳解
網路埠 在 網路技術中,埠 port 有好幾種意思。集線器 交換機 路由器的埠指的是連線其他 網路裝置的 介面,如 rj 45埠 serial埠等。我們 這裡所指的埠 不是指物理意義上的埠,而是特指tcp ip協議中的埠,是邏輯意義上的埠。電腦執行的系統程式,其實就像乙個閉合的圓圈,但是電腦是為人服...
計算機網路9 計算機網路效能
1.網路效能的衡量指標 2.速率 3.頻寬 4.延遲 5.丟包率 6.時延頻寬積 7.吞吐率 網路效能的好壞可以由網路的速率 頻寬 延遲 丟包率 網路頻寬積 吞吐率等方面來判斷,下面讓我們一一詳細介紹。速率 資料率 data rate 也稱 資料傳輸速率或位元率 bit rate 指的是 單位時間 ...
計算機網路 計算機網路的效能
目錄 1.網路效能的衡量指標 2.速率 3.頻寬 4.延遲 5.丟包率 6.時延頻寬積 7.吞吐率 網路效能的好壞可以由網路的速率 頻寬 延遲 丟包率 網路頻寬積 吞吐率等方面來判斷,下面讓我們一一詳細介紹。速率 資料率 data rate 也稱 資料傳輸速率或位元率 bit rate 指的是 單位...